
According to Dallas County Medical Society Alliance Past President/Champion Sandy Secor,
“A Back- to-School Vaccine and Sports Physical Health Fair event is taking place on Saturday, August 13, from 1 p.m. to 3 p.m., at Church of the Incarnation, 3966 McKinney Ave., Dallas.
“I have been the Champion and leading organizer for free immunizations, sports physicals and dental screenings for low income students in the Uptown and East Dallas area for over 12 years.
“Church of the Incarnation, Dallas County Medical Society Alliance, Care Van, North Dallas Shared Ministries, Texas A&M Dental School and the Dallas Police Dept. participate in this event.
“The students from North Dallas High School, Spence Middle School and the surrounding elementary schools benefit from the free vaccines, free sports physicals and dental care. Physicians from DCMSA provide the sports physicals. The physicians are a diverse crowd, and include OBGYN, Cardiology, Neurology, Internal Medicine, Ophthalmology, Gastroenterology and even a transplant surgeon have volunteered their time to serve these students.

“The families are provided school supplies as they exit the event. This has been the last chance to get free childhood vaccines and sports physicals before school starts.
“This project is important to the students and families in the area. Students come from Roseland Homes, East Dallas and the surrounding areas. It is our privilege to serve them.
“Some of the students receiving these services are homeless. Church of the Incarnation has Incarnation House serving the homeless students at North Dallas High School.
“Sports physicals provide the student the ability to participate in athletics and band. It keeps them out of gangs and helps them excel in sports and other school activities.
“This year we provided sports physicals in May for around 160 students. We expect that many in August. Last year Care Van administered over 135 vaccines.
